HGV Driver
Location: Scania Southampton
Working Hours: Monday – Friday 08:00 – 16:30 with occasional Saturday mornings
Salary: From £13.51 plus an excellent benefits package, including:
- In-house training provided to support career progression
- 25 days holiday + public holidays which increases with service
- Competitive employer pension
- Discounts on major retail outlets, including groceries
- 4x basic salary life insurance
- Eligibility to receive an annual ‘Company Success Payment’
We have an exciting opportunity for an experienced HGV driver to play a key role within the day to day running of our Southampton branch. As HGV Driver and Branch Maintenance, you will hold a HGV C+E license to assist the workshop in the moving of customers\’ vehicles, presenting them for MOT and collecting and delivering vehicles between customers\’ premises and the branch.
We are looking for someone who takes pride in their work and enjoys delivering a great service.
Key Responsibilities
- HGV C+E license required – ADR preferred
- Present vehicles for MOT / At third part suppliers
- Delivery and Collection of vehicles
- Delivery of parts orders to customers when required
- General day to day branch up keep to support a safe place to work
